I received a database in this format: FB_BRANDID|FB_MODELID|FB_TEXTID|FB_TEXT|FB_TYPEID|FB_COUNTRYID 19|5783|38742|mn_4x4_synchrone_l. Jpg|10|1 19|5783|38744|mn_4x4_synchrone_s. Jpg|11|1 ... and so on Is there any way to imprt that in my MySQL database?

I am using phpMyAdmin. From what I can see, it won't allow me to import that kind of file. Any help is appreciated.

This is possible via phpMyAdmin. Import a CSV-file, but replace the semicolon with the pipe |. Empty the input "Fields enclosed by" and check the box "Column names in first row".
